"South Korea's 15M-User Digital Bank Revolutionizes Overseas Transfers with Solana Stablecoins"

In a groundbreaking move, South Korea's largest digital bank, boasting an impressive 15 million users, has announced its plans to leverage Solana stablecoins to streamline overseas transfers. This strategic decision is poised to significantly enhance the bank's cross-border payment capabilities, offering customers faster, cheaper, and more efficient transactions.

Key Developments
The digital bank, known for its innovative approach to financial services, has been exploring ways to improve its international remittance services. By integrating Solana stablecoins into its platform, the bank aims to reduce transaction costs and processing times, making it an attractive option for customers who frequently send money abroad. The partnership is expected to be facilitated through a regulated app, ensuring that customer relationships remain within a secure and compliant environment. However, the exact launch details, including the timeline and specific features, remain under wraps.
